Decoding the Technology: How Robot Vacuums Operate
Behind their unassuming exterior lies a complicated network of sensors, algorithms, and mechanical parts that make it possible for robot vacuum cleaners to autonomously navigate and clean your floors. Comprehending the core innovations at play supplies a much deeper gratitude for these smart devices:

1. Navigation and Mapping:

Sensors: Robot vacuums are equipped with a range of sensors, including:
Bump Sensors: These identify physical obstacles, enabling the robot to alter direction upon collision.Cliff Sensors: Located on the bottom, these infrared sensing units prevent the robot from dropping stairs or ledges by detecting sudden drops.Wall Sensors: These assist the robot follow walls and edges for thorough cleaning along borders.Optical or Visual Sensors: More sophisticated models utilize video cameras and visual mapping innovation (SLAM - Simultaneous Localization and Mapping) to produce a detailed map of the home. This enables for more organized cleaning patterns and targeted room cleaning.Gyroscope and Accelerometer: These help track the robot's motion and orientation, helping in effective navigation.
Navigation Algorithms: Based on sensing unit data, advanced algorithms assist the robot's cleaning course. Typical navigation patterns consist of:
Random Bounce: Simple models use a random pattern, bouncing off challenges until the location is covered-- although less effective, it still cleans up.Spiral Cleaning: The robot relocates gradually larger spirals to clean a concentrated location.Edge Cleaning: The robot follows the perimeter of the space to guarantee edges and corners are addressed.Systematic Cleaning (Zig-Zag, Row-by-Row): Advanced models with mapping capabilities clean in organized lines, maximizing protection and efficiency.
2. Cleaning Mechanisms:

Brushes: Most robot vacuums utilize a combination of brushes to loosen and lift dirt and debris.
Main Brush (Roller Brush): Located beneath, this turning brush agitates carpets and sweeps particles towards the suction inlet. Bristles are typically created for various floor types.Side Brushes: Extending out from the side of the robot, these small brushes sweep debris from edges and corners towards the main brush.
Suction Power: A motor generates suction to draw dust and particles into the dustbin. Suction power differs between designs, affecting their effectiveness on various floor types and with different types of particles, like pet hair.

Dustbin: Collected dirt and particles are saved in an internal dustbin. Capacity differs, and some designs offer self-emptying features where the dustbin is instantly cleared into a larger base station.
A Spectrum of Choices: Types of Robot Vacuum Cleaners
The robot vacuum market varies, providing models customized to different needs and budgets. Here are some essential categories:

Basic Robot Vacuums: These are typically affordable and offer fundamental cleaning functions like random navigation, standard brushes, and dust collection. They appropriate for smaller areas and lighter cleaning needs.

Smart Mapping Robot Vacuums: Equipped with visual or LiDAR (Light Detection and Ranging) mapping, these models create comprehensive maps of your home. This allows features like:
Room-by-Room Cleaning: You can designate particular rooms to be cleaned.No-Go Zones: Establish virtual borders to prevent the robot from entering specific areas.Custom-made Cleaning Schedules: Set cleaning schedules for particular spaces or zones at various times.
Robot Vacuum Mops: Many contemporary robot vacuums incorporate mopping performance. These normally have a water tank and a mopping pad that damp-wipes difficult floorings after vacuuming or as a standalone mopping cycle. Some advanced models can differentiate in between vacuuming and mopping modes successfully.

Self-Emptying Robot Vacuums: For supreme benefit, self-emptying models automatically move collected debris from the robot's dustbin into a larger dust bag or bin within a docking station. This considerably lowers the frequency of manual dustbin clearing.

Pet-Friendly Robot Vacuums: Designed particularly to deal with pet hair, these designs often include stronger suction, tangle-free brush styles, and bigger dustbins to handle the demands of pet-owning homes.

Browsing the Purchase: Choosing the Right Robot Vacuum for You
Choosing the perfect robot vacuum requires mindful factor to consider of your particular requirements and home environment. Here are key aspects to assess:

Home Size and Layout: Larger homes or multi-story homes may benefit from models with longer battery life and smart mapping for effective protection. Complex layouts with various barriers may necessitate sophisticated navigation functions.

Floor Types: Consider the dominant floor types in your home. For primarily tough floors, a basic model with good suction and mopping abilities might be enough. Houses with carpets and rugs will require models with stronger suction and brush styles reliable on carpets.

Pet Ownership: If you have pets, focus on pet-friendly designs with strong suction, tangle-free brushes, and larger dustbins to handle pet hair successfully. HEPA purification is likewise extremely helpful for pet allergic reactions.

Budget plan: Robot vacuum prices vary widely. Determine your budget plan and prioritize features that are essential to you. Basic models provide important cleaning at lower price points, while advanced features included greater costs.

Smart Features: Evaluate the worth of smart functions like mapping, space selection, no-go zones, app control, and voice assistant integration based upon your tech savviness and desired level of control.

Battery Life and Charging Time: Ensure the battery life is adequate to clean your home on a single charge. Consider the charging time too.

Maintenance Requirements: Research the ease of dustbin emptying, brush cleaning, and filter replacement for various designs. Self-emptying models lower maintenance frequency, but may have higher upfront costs.

Noise Level: Robot auto vacuum noise levels vary. If sound level of sensitivity is a concern, examine the decibel ranking of different models.

Frequently Asked Questions (FAQs) about Robot Vacuum Cleaners
Q: Are robot vacuum efficient at cleaning?A: Yes, robot vacuums work for daily maintenance cleaning, getting rid of dust, dirt, and pet hair from floorings. Advanced models with strong suction and mapping are especially reliable. While they may not have the power of a full-size vacuum for deep cleaning greatly stained areas, they are outstanding for consistent upkeep.

Q: How long do robot vacuum batteries last?A: Battery life differs in between models, normally varying from 60 to 120 minutes on a single charge. Advanced models typically have longer run times. Some designs likewise use recharge and resume functions, returning to the charging dock and after that continuing cleaning from where they ended.

Q: Are robot vacuums loud?A: Robot vacuum noise levels differ. Some fundamental designs can be fairly quiet, while those with more powerful suction motors may be louder, but typically still quieter than traditional vacuums. Noise levels are usually similar to a low discussion or a running dishwashing machine.

Q: Can robot vacuums handle pet hair?A: Many robot vacuums are particularly developed for pet hair. Look for designs promoted as pet-friendly, which normally feature stronger suction, tangle-free brushes, and larger dustbins to manage pet hair successfully. HEPA filters are also advantageous for pet allergy victims.

Q: Can robot vacuums clean carpets?A: Yes, numerous robot vacuums can clean up carpets, especially low-pile carpets and carpets. Models with stronger suction and brush styles optimized for carpets are more reliable. However, for deep cleaning high-pile carpets, a conventional upright vacuum may still be necessary.

Q: Do robot vacuums need a lot of upkeep?A: Robot vacuums require some upkeep, but it is usually simple. Routine jobs consist of emptying the dustbin, cleaning brushes, and changing filters. Self-emptying designs considerably lower the frequency of dustbin emptying.
